Webevaluated for special education and disability-related services in a timely manner” (p. 24). Once appropriately identified, English learners with disabilities must receive the specific language and disability-related services that meet the student’s individual needs. Identifying and serving English learners with disabilities is no simple task. WebThe Disability Standards for Education 2005 (the Standards) clarify the obligations of education and training providers under the Disability Discrimination Act 1992. The Guidance Notes provide additional explanation on how the Standards can be applied in practice. Information products to help you understand your rights and obligations. The …
